While yin yang is a Chinese term, it refers to a concept of balance and duality. While it may seem like a paradox that two opposing forces can create unity, it is the key to finding balance. The scholars of this 3rd century BCE Chinese school studied yin yang as it relates to astronomy. Yin yang was even the foundation of the Yinyang School of Cosmology, founded by Zou Yan. For example, yang represented the winter solstice, and yin represented the summer solstice. It was originally used in Chinese time-keeping and measures the position of the sun using the shadow or shade a pole creates. The yin yang symbol was invented in 600 BCE in ancient China. In modern Asian cultures, the concepts of yin and yang creating balance and harmony influence things like feng shui, politics, behavior, beliefs, traditional Chinese medicine, art, science, and more. This concept influenced Daoism, founder of Taoism Lao Tzu, and founder of Confucianism Confucius. This concept of balance and flow in nature grew in popularity during the Warring States Period and the Spring and Autumn Period. ![]() In the 9th century BCE, King Wen wrote about yin and yang in the Book of Changes, which is also known as the I Ching or Zhouyi. The concepts of yin and yang date back to the Yin dynasty and Western Zhou dynasty, which took place from 1400 and11 and 771 BCE, respectively. What Is the Etymology of the Word Yin Yang? The yin-yang symbol - also called the Tai Chi symbol - is a circle divided in half via a curved line. According to Chinese culture and religion, the opposing forces create balance in the natural world. The yang side represents heaven and chaos. Yang energy is masculine, bright, positive, and outward. Yin energy is feminine, negative, dark, and inward. This philosophy asserts that the universe is made of forces that compete with and complement one another like male and female, sun and moon, or dark and light. What Does the Word Yin Yang Mean?Īccording to Thought Co and Britannica, yin and yang refers to the belief that the universe is governed by a sense of cosmic balance and duality of cosmic energies that are present in nature. ![]() New protected areas are being designated for some gorilla populations, and the population of mountain gorillas has continued to increase in recent years, leading to its downlisting from Critically Endangered to Endangered in November 2018. Both gorilla species have been decreasing in numbers for decades, and a 2010 United Nations report suggests that they may disappear from large parts of the Congo Basin by the mid-2020s.Ĭonservation efforts by WWF, other organizations, and governments are making a difference for gorillas. This low rate of reproduction makes it difficult for gorillas to recover from population declines. Once a female begins to breed, she'll likely give birth to only one baby every four to six years and only three or four over her entire lifetime. Females become sexually mature around seven or eight years old but don’t begin to breed until a couple of years later. The two gorilla species live in equatorial Africa, separated by about 560 miles of Congo Basin forest. The largest of the great apes, gorillas are stocky animals with broad chests and shoulders, large, human-like hands, and small eyes set into hairless faces. Shaved gorilla code#In fact, gorillas share 98.3% of their genetic code with humans, making them our closest cousins after chimpanzees and bonobos. Gorillas are gentle giants and display many human-like behaviors and emotions, such as laughter and sadness. ![]() ![]() The lodge features 12 guest rooms, each with its own bathroom and plenty of space to unwind as well.
